Originally Posted by u.s mma
do you have build pics? what is the frame? leaf springs? cmon, details. that is really cool bro.
home built frame 4" square tubing, 5"x3"pull piont reinforcements, 1 5/8" round tube ties the shackle drops to the frame
i used a set of class A dodge motorhome leaf springs front and back because i had all this stuff just laying around

engine is a 92 Cummins rotary pump modded by me 3200 spring and with every screw in the thing tampered with, some crappy bosch 190's that needed to be timed to the head, water to air aftercooler with a home built 3" inlet insted of a 2"er, 14cm2 housing that i pluged the wastegate on but thats got to go in exchange for the 60/12 i have on my other first gen same with the injectors ( by the way it had 330,xxx miles when i pulled it )

trans is a 727 that i got on ebay a while back as i was planning this insanity for some time it had just been rebuilt and the truck was totaled i got it for 300 bucks
